Output 20a31ac461b21c7d8e373e6728f140b323fb56ad43c50f4ce2cf6b0d4bfb26f7:25

value
953884
script pubkey
OP_0 OP_PUSHBYTES_20 3018af6ad3f2a425dca23b4438232efd6a1316b5
address
bc1qxqv276kn72jzth9z8dzrsgewl44px944ljrfr7
transaction
20a31ac461b21c7d8e373e6728f140b323fb56ad43c50f4ce2cf6b0d4bfb26f7
confirmations
152155
spent
true